==Record Offices==
'''For Births and Deaths'''
[http://moh.gov.lr/ Ministry of Health and Social Welfare]<br>
P. O. Box 10-9009<br>
1000 Monrovia 10 <br>
Liberia<br>
West Africa<br>
'''For Statutory/Western/Faith-based Marriages'''
[https://cndra.gov.lr/index.php The Center for National Documents, Records and Archives (CNDRA)]<br>
National Archives Building 12th Street<br>
Sinkor, Monrovia<br>
Liberia<br>
West Africa<br>
Telephone: 0770- 824304<br>
Email: [mailto:info@cndra.gov.lr info@cndra.gov.lr]<br>
'''For Traditional/Customary Marriages'''
[http://www.mia.gov.lr/index.php Ministry of Internal Affairs]<br>
Email: [http://www.mia.gov.lr/2content.php?sub=168&related=23&third=168&pg=sp Form to send an email]
'''For Divorces'''
Divorces are supposed to be done in a court. Records of divorce cases are confidential, and the records should not be shared with anyone. 
However for traditional marriages, the divorce could be done in a variety of ways according to customs and traditions.<ref>corpusjurisliberia, [https://corpusjurisliberia.wordpress.com/tag/grounds-for-divorce/ Divorce: An Overview of the Law], accessed 17 December 2019.</ref>
